Here's the exact setup for anyone running local LLMs on 6-8 GB VRAM: llama.cpp server flags (on my NVIDIA RTX 4060 8gb VRAM): -m gemma-4-26B-A4B-it-qat-UD-Q4_K_XL.gguf --cache-type-k q8_0 --cache-type-v q8_0 -c 150000 --port 8080 Throughput with quantization: Prefill: 200-250 tokens/sec Decode: 20-25 tokens/sec reduce context if oom on 6 gb vram card. Key learnings: - Quantize KV cache to q8 for faster prefill/decode. Prefill goes from 100-150 (unquantized) to 200-250 tok/s (q8). - But watch out, once actual context grows past ~50k tokens on high entropy workloads, q8 KV quantization can cause hallucinations. Low entropy workloads are mostly unaffected. If you see it happening, drop the quantization. This is common across all local models. - In Hermes Agent settings -> Memory & Context, bump compression threshold from default 0.5 to 0.7. Default triggers way too frequent context compression and eats time. Up next: add persistent memory, web search, tool calling, streaming output and whatever you suggest. Another WTF moment. A developer just open-sourced a coding agent harness that boots 245x faster than Claude Code. It's called jcode. You launch it and the first frame renders in 14 milliseconds. Claude Code takes 3,436. One active session uses 27.8 MB of RAM. Claude Code uses 386.6. Run ten sessions in parallel and jcode holds at 117 MB while OpenCode swells to 3.2 GB. Each agent has a semantic memory graph instead of a scratchpad. Every turn gets embedded as a vector. The graph is queried on every turn for related memories, and a sideagent verifies the hits before injecting them into context. Consolidation runs in the background to check for stale or conflicting facts. No manual /remember calls. No token burn on lookup tools. The provider list is 30+ deep. Claude, ChatGPT, Gemini, GitHub Copilot, Azure, OpenRouter, DeepSeek, Groq, Mistral, Perplexity, Fireworks, Ollama, LM Studio, and any OpenAI-compatible endpoint you point it at. Ran out of tokens on your first ChatGPT Pro sub? /account swaps to the second. Then there's Swarm. Spawn two agents in the same repo and the server manages them. When agent A edits a file agent B has been reading, agent B gets pinged and can check the diff. Agents can DM each other, broadcast to the room, or spawn their own worker teams for parallel tasks. Groups, channels, and completion statuses are handled automatically. The UI has live side panels that render mermaid diagrams inline. To make it fast, the author wrote a Rust mermaid renderer 1800x faster than the JavaScript one, then wrote a custom terminal called Handterm because no existing terminal could do smooth partial-line scrolling. Self-dev mode is where it gets wild. Tell your agent to enter self-dev and it starts editing jcode's own source code, rebuilds the binary, reloads it live, and keeps working across your existing sessions. You can also resume broken sessions from Claude Code, Codex, OpenCode, or pi directly inside jcode. Anthropic's cache goes cold at the 5-minute mark and you're staring down a big cache miss on your next turn? The UI warns you before you spend the tokens. Written in Rust. MIT licensed. Runs on macOS, Windows, Linux, and Termux. Sitting at 11.2k stars with a native iOS app coming.

HERMES AGENT NOW SUPPORTS COMPUTER USE ON WINDOWS AND LINUX. CLICKS, TYPES, SCROLLS YOUR DESKTOP IN THE BACKGROUND WHILE YOU WORK. computer use was macOS only. now it works on Windows and Linux too via Cua. Nous Research HOW IT WORKS: cua-driver runs as an MCP server. Hermes takes a screenshot with numbered elements. clicks element #14 (the search field). types a query. submits. reads the result. during all of this: → your cursor stays where you left it → keyboard focus doesn't change → windows don't come to front → macOS doesn't switch Spaces you and the agent co-work on the same machine. WHAT IT CAN DO: → find your latest Stripe email and summarize it → fill forms in a web app that has no API → navigate desktop apps (Mail, browser, Finder) → interact with any GUI application → extract data from apps only accessible via screen WORKS WITH ANY VISION MODEL: not locked to Anthropic. | Provider | Works | |---|---| | Claude (Sonnet/Opus) | best overall | | GPT-4+, GPT-5.5 | full support | | Gemini (via OpenRouter) | full support | | Local vLLM / LM Studio | if model supports vision | | Text-only models | degraded (accessibility tree only) | SETUP: hermes computer-use install or: hermes tools → Computer Use → cua-driver grant permissions when prompted: → Accessibility (system settings) → Screen Recording (system settings) start a session: hermes -t computer_use chat or add to config.yaml / Desktop app settings to enable permanently. SAFETY: → destructive actions require your approval → blocked key combos: empty trash, force delete, lock screen, log out → blocked type patterns: curl | bash, sudo rm -rf /, fork bombs → agent cannot click permission dialogs → agent cannot type passwords → agent cannot follow instructions embedded in screenshots pair with approvals.mode: manual if you want every single click confirmed. TOKEN NOTE: screenshots are expensive. each one adds vision tokens to context. use computer_use for tasks where no API exists. if the tool has an API or MCP server, use that instead. 15 levels of Hermes Agent👇

Big win for open-source LLMs! DeepSeek V4 Pro holds the top open-weights score on SWE-bench Verified, in the GPT-5.5 range. GLM 5.2 leads the open-weight intelligence index and sits near the closed frontier on long-horizon coding. But this leaderboard number is a weak proxy for real performance. It comes from one task set, run through one harness, served at one precision. The same weights can even score differently across providers, since many hosts quantize activations to fp8 and drift the model off its reference weights. Real performance is determined based on whether a model can read a repo, make coordinated edits across files, run the tests, and recover when one breaks. By that measure, the top open models hold up, but only inside the right harness. The teams that actually put DeepSeek V4 into production pipelines as a frontier substitute got there through the harness they built around the model, not by picking a stronger model.
